Beschrijving

Jenn and Carrie explore the evolving landscape of sports media, audience demographics, and the influence of money and stereotypes. They also delve into recent legal cases involving Ben Affleck’s recent movie The Rip, Kim Kardashian’s insta-no lawsuit, and, of course, Alex Murdaugh. They also are very unserious about celebrities and the intersection of politics and reality TV in Los Angeles. World Cup 2026 Pt. 1: The Hidden Corruption of FIFA and a Deep Dive into the World Cup Scandals

World Cup 2026 Pt. 1: The Hidden Corruption of FIFA and a Deep Dive into the World Cup Scandal Recorded June 1, 2026 This episode explores the complex and often corrupt world of FIFA and the World Cup, delving into historical scandals, the influence of money, and the political implications behind the world's biggest sporting event. Hosted by Jenn and Carrie, it offers well-researched insights and provocative theories.
